Match Summary
Vancouver Whitecaps II defeated Portland Timbers II 4:1. The match was played in MLS Next Pro 2025. Goals were scored by R. Elloumi 18′, N. Pierre 36′, J. Castro 45′ (pen.), C. Kachwele 63′, G. Guerra 67′ (pen.). 7 yellow cards were shown, 1 red cards. Vancouver Whitecaps II made 5 substitutions, Portland Timbers II made 4.
